Considering the difficult epidemiological situation in Kyrgyzstan, associated with a sharp increase in the number of people infected with coronavirus and an acute shortage of medical personnel, the Embassy, together with compatriot Dr. Erkin Ismail, working in a private clinic in Ankara, in order to work in hospitals in Kyrgyzstan, has formed a group of medical workers consisting o  18 Kyrgyz citizens undergoing residency and working in Turkey.

With the relevant ministries of Turkey, the Embassy worked out the issue of obtaining permission for the departure of medical workers to Kyrgyzstan, some of which are already in Kyrgyzstan.

Medical workers will be sent to Kyrgyzstan on July 15, 2020 by a charter flight of Turkish Airlines. The costs of acquiring airline tickets and living in Kyrgyzstan are covered by sponsorship.
